Summary
By ensuring that monitoring arrangements are considered at the design stage of a new plant it should be possible to ensure that stack emission monitoring measurements are both reliable and compliant with legislation.
Sampling platforms
The sample location must be situated where it is possible to erect suitable working platforms. Ideally, the measurement site should be easily and safely accessible via stairs.
Measurements of velocity and of pollutants in a particulate phase require a suffi ciently large working area around the stack, so that specifi ed measurement points in the stack can be sampled with the appropriate length sample probe. In summary:
• the platform surface area should not be less than 5m2
• the minimum length in front of the access port shall be 2m or the length of the probe (which includes nozzles, suction/ support tubes and associated fi lter holders) plus 1m (whichever is the greater)
• the platform should be wide enough to prevent sampling equipment extending beyond the platform
